Cathode ray tubes (CRTs) used in old-style televisions have been replaced by modern LCD and LED screens. Part of the CRT included a set of accelerating plates separated by a distance of about 1.62 cm. If the potential difference across the plates was 29.5 kV, find the magnitude of the electric field (in V/m) in the region between the plates.
